Can you play PS3 in PS4?

The short answer is that no, the PlayStation 4 is not backward-compatible with PlayStation 3 games. Inserting a PS3 disc into the PS4 will not work. And you cannot download digital versions of PS3 games from the PlayStation Store onto your PlayStation 4.

How long is RDR2 story?

Exploring the Old West in Red Dead Redemption 2 is going to be an epic affair, as a new report says the game’s story will take roughly 60 hours to complete.
